    Summer Living History Program

    August 8 – 10:00 AM - 5:00 PM Summer Living History Program
    Rock Ledge Ranch Historic Site 3105 Gateway Road, Colorado Springs, Colorado, United States

    Visit us and experience Colorado history in style here at Rock Ledge Ranch Historic Site. Learn about Native American trade at the American Indian Area. Make a cornhusk doll at the Homestead Cabin. Discover the hard-working and ingenuous spirit of early pioneer homesteaders and farmers in our 1880s Garden. Perfect your skills at Victorian games and tour the 1870s Rock Ledge House. Listen to the rhythmic 'clink, clink' of the blacksmith's hammer hitting the anvil as you immerse yourself in the life of an 1890s blacksmith. Explore the 1907 Orchard House while you learn about life for Edwardian servants and upper-class citizens of Colorado Springs.

    To keep meat from spoiling during the curing process, farmers processed hogs in the cooler fall months. Pioneers wouldn’t waste anything from a pig.
